Adams Lane bridge opens

The Adams Lane bridge over U.S. 41 opened on Friday.  

According to the I-69 Ohio River Crossing, crews have replaced the superstructure, which includes the beams and bridge deck.

Crews also made upgrades to the barrier and guardrail. The improvements will greatly extend the life of the bridge.
 
Drivers should look for crews completing finishing touches at the Adams Lane bridge over the next several weeks, I-69 ORX. Work will include final asphalt surfacing, drainage boxes, curb and gutters.
 
Officials say that reopening the bridge will provide another option for drivers impacted by the recent closure of the Airline Road bridge over U.S. 41.  

The official detour for Airline Road closure will now be routed on Adams Lane. Road signs will be installed marking the new detour. Similar improvements are underway on the Airline Road bridge. The Airline Road bridge is expected to reopen in August

City starts street milling Monday

The city of Henderson will begin milling streets and alleys this week in preparation for patching, paving and repair projects, said a release from the city.

Work will be done over the next two to three weeks, but the schedule is subject to change as it is influenced by weather conditions and other factors. 

Temporary closures and/or delays may occur during construction, said the city.

The city also asked that residents move all vehicles from the street by 6 a.m. each day until the work is completed.

If road closures are required, detours will be set up, and there will be flaggers and/or signs to direct traffic during construction, the city said.

Here is a list of public streets/areas on the work list:

  • Fagan Street from Clay Street to Meadow Street
  • O’Byrne Street from Meadow Street to Mill Street
  • Russell Drive from Old Madisonville Road to Country Drive
  • Turnagain Drive from Old Madisonville Road to 1755 Turnagain Dive
  • North and South Downey Drive from Turnagain Drive to the end of the road
  • Sand Lane from South Green Street to South Main Street
  • Bittersweet Lane from Heather Lane to 513 Bittersweet Lane
  • SportPlex parking lot will receive surface asphalt
